Support means at least paying for food, clothing and shelter. But under VA Code 20-108.2, the source for child support laws in Virginia, support can also include medical coverage, dental expenses, and even psychological services such as a counselor or therapist.
Multiply weekly financial data by 4.33. multiply bi-weekly financial data by 2.167. multiply semi-monthly financial data by 2. divide annual financial data by 12.
If the combined family income is $35,000 or greater per month, it falls outside the table and support is based on a percentage of income from 2.6% for one child to 5% for six children. Items that are added to the support obligation include the cost of health insurance and any work-related childcare expenses.
